Final Bruin Regular Double-Header at Rejoice

Tuesday night is our final night of regular season high school basketball across the area, as most teams will have their final tune ups before the playoffs begin over the next 10 days.

At Bartlesville High, it is a non-District tuneup for both BHS teams at Rejoice Christian.

BHS swept Rejoice in Bruin Field House before Thanksgiving.

On the girl’s side, it is a final chance to get back on track. The Lady Bruins dropped a tough one to Stillwater at home on Friday. BHS beat Rejoice in November, 72-68.

The BHS girls are 13-9 and are vying for their 14th win before the postseason. Lady Bruins have already wrapped up a 6th place finish in 6A District 3.

On the guy’s side it will be a much taller task. The Bruin boys beat Rejoice in November, 51-28. However, that was without all the Eagles football players early in the season.

Coming off the victory over Stillwater on Friday, head coach Jake Christenson says his team is having to learn how to win. 

A 6:30 tip for the girls with the guys to follow at 8:00 on KWON – AM 1400, FM 93.3 and 95.1. Video coverage on KWONTV.com.

It is the final double-header of the season for BHS.

The Bruin boys have added a game on Feb. 23 at home against Pryor.
